在JavaScript的世界里,`window.location`是一个非常强大的对象,它能够帮助我们获取当前网页的URL信息。今天,我们就来聊聊其中的`search`属性!👀
`window.location.search`主要用于获取URL中的查询字符串部分,也就是从问号(`?`)开始的部分。比如,对于URL:`https://example.com/page.html?name=John&age=25`,`search`会返回`"?name=John&age=25"`。😎
这个功能特别适合用来解析URL参数,比如获取用户的搜索关键词或设置的过滤条件。通过简单的字符串操作或者借助正则表达式,我们可以轻松提取出具体的参数值,如`name=John`或`age=25`。🚀
使用时需要注意,如果URL中没有查询字符串,`search`会返回一个空字符串(`""`)。因此,在实际开发中建议先检查是否为空,再进行后续处理。😉
掌握好`window.location.search`,可以让我们的前端代码更加灵活高效!快去试试吧!💻✨